450 Watt Solar Panel Prices in India 2025: What You Need to Know Before Buying

Understanding India's Solar Panel Market Dynamics

India's solar energy sector has been growing faster than Mumbai traffic during monsoon season. With the government's ambitious 500 GW renewable energy target by 2030, solar panel prices have become more competitive than a Delhi market vendor's best offer. Let's break down what you're really paying for when purchasing a 450W solar panel.

Key Price Determinants for 450W Panels

  • Panel Technology: Mono PERC vs. Polycrystalline (spoiler: Mono's winning the efficiency race)
  • Brand reputation - Tata Solar vs. Waaree vs. international players
  • BIS certification status (non-negotiable for quality assurance)
  • Warranty packages - 25-year performance guarantees aren't just marketing fluff

2025 Price Breakdown: What's the Damage?

Current market rates for 450W solar panels in India hover between ₹18-25 per watt. That translates to:

  • Basic polycrystalline models: ₹8,100 - ₹9,500 per panel
  • Premium mono PERC units: ₹10,800 - ₹12,500 per panel

The Hidden Value in Tier-1 Manufacturers

While cheaper panels might tempt you like a roadside kulfi vendor, Tier-1 manufacturers offer:

  • 0.5% annual degradation rates vs. 1% in budget panels
  • 92% output retention after 10 years
  • Advanced PID resistance for India's harsh climates

Smart Shopping Strategies

Navigating India's solar market requires more finesse than bargaining at Sarojini Nagar. Pro tips:

  • Always request tested STC and NOCT performance data
  • Compare temperature coefficients - crucial for Rajasthan summers
  • Factor in MNRE subsidies (currently 30-40% for residential installations)

Recent data from the National Solar Portal reveals that systems using 450W panels achieve 18-22% better space efficiency compared to 330W models. That's the difference between powering your home and your neighbor's LED billboard!
